Understanding the Mechanics of Kalshi Trading

At its core, kalshi operates as a designated contract market, regulated by the Commodity Futures Trading Commission (CFTC) in the United States. This regulatory oversight provides a level of security and transparency not always found in other emerging financial platforms. Users don’t directly bet on events; instead, they trade contracts that pay out based on the eventual outcome. The price of these contracts fluctuates based on supply and demand, reflecting the collective beliefs of traders regarding the likelihood of a particular event occurring. This dynamic pricing creates opportunities for both buyers and sellers to profit from discrepancies in market expectations.

The Potential for Market Efficiency through Kalshi

One of the intriguing aspects of kalshi is its potential to improve market efficiency. By aggregating the collective wisdom of a diverse group of traders, the platform can generate more accurate predictions about future events than might be possible through traditional forecasting methods. The prices of kalshi contracts can serve as a valuable indicator of market sentiment and probability, providing insights for policymakers, businesses, and individuals. When the market consistently predicts an event with a high degree of certainty, it suggests that the underlying factors are strongly aligned in favor of that outcome.

However, it's important to recognize that kalshi is not a perfect predictor of the future. Unexpected events, such as black swan events, can disrupt even the most accurate forecasts. Additionally, market manipulation and irrational exuberance can sometimes lead to mispricing of contracts. Risk Management Strategies for Kalshi Trading

Like all forms of trading, kalshi carries inherent risks. It’s essential to understand these risks and implement appropriate risk management strategies to protect your capital. One of the primary risks is leverage, as mentioned earlier. While leverage can amplify profits, it can also magnify losses. Therefore, it's crucial to use leverage responsibly and avoid overextending yourself. Diversification is another important risk management technique. Spreading your investments across a variety of events can help to reduce your exposure to any single outcome.

Stop-loss orders can be used to automatically exit a trade if the price moves against you. This can help to limit your potential losses. Position sizing is also critical. Don't risk more than a small percentage of your trading capital on any single trade. Furthermore, it is imperative to conduct thorough research before trading any contract. Understand the underlying event, the factors that might influence its outcome, and the potential risks and rewards. Emotional discipline is essential; avoid making impulsive decisions based on fear or greed.
